Barry Eric Odell Pain (Sep 28, 1864 - May 5, 1928) was an English journalist, poet and writer. Born in Cambridge, and educated at the university, he became a prominent contributor to "The Granta". He was known as a writer of parody and lightly humorous stories. The 9.43 is a short story by Barry Pain, included in “Eliza”. The story follows an English couple, planning to visit St. Paul’s Cathedral. The train they were planning to take supposed to leave at 9.43. Or at 9.53. A seemingly meaningless mistake is all that it takes to start another comic and absurd argument with Eliza. Will the couple make it to the train in time?
